What affects the price

Legal fees for immigration cases vary based on the specific type of application you are filing. Generally, a straightforward visa renewal or document update costs less than complex proceedings like deportation defense or permanent residency petitions involving multiple family members. The total time a lawyer spends gathering evidence, drafting declarations, and attending interviews also influences the final bill. Cases with prior criminal issues or complex travel histories often require more intensive research and strategy sessions, which adds to the work involved. Exact pricing confirmed free on the call.

What exactly do immigration lawyers do?

Immigration lawyers handle the legal aspects of immigration, including filling out applications, preparing clients for interviews, and representing them in immigration court. They stay updated on constantly changing laws and regulations to provide the most accurate advice. Their goal is to guide clients through the immigration system efficiently and effectively.
